Join Alex Sarlin and Ben Kornell as they explore the most critical developments in the world of education technology this week:
🤑 Prosus Zeroes Out Its 9.6% Stake In BYJU’s
📊 New LearnPlatform by Instructure Report Finds Increases in More Unique Digital Tools Accessed by K-12 Institutions, Students, and Teachers
🏫 LAUSD/Allhere issues
đź’¬ Speak raises $20M - US, Language Learning - Buckley Startup Fund, OpenAI Startup Fund, Khosla Ventures
đź§ MEandMine raises $4.5M - US, Mental Health - K5 Global
📉 Chegg cuts 23% of workforce, 441 employees
Plus special guests, Elyas Felfoul of WISE, Arijit Raychowdhury of Georgia Institute of Technology, and Lindsay Jones of CAST
